GOODBYE, SLEEPLESS NIGHTS
How to ‘Shuffle’ Your Way to Restful Dreams
A good night’s rest is one of the keys to a healthy life, but if counting sheep isn’t working for you, a psychology-based sleep hack can help quiet your most intrusive thoughts. Cognitive shuffling is a technique that aims to disrupt your thought patterns by focusing on random words to help your mind relax. It’s like shuffling a deck of cards — rearranging all the ideas to quiet the noise so you can sleep. Get ready to finally catch some z’s with this clever strategy to take you into dreamland. SHUFFLE OFF TO SLEEP To turn this trick into a sleep triumph, get into bed, turn off the lights, and try to relax. As you lie there, think of a non-emotional word, like “rest,” or a similar word around five letters long and doesn’t cause an emotional reaction. Now, think of three words that start with the first letter of the word — like rain, road, and rosy.
Repeat this for each letter until you finish the word you first chose. As you think about the words, spell them out slowly and visualize them. This practice resets your mind as you focus on something other than thoughts or feelings that keep you awake. MIND MOVIES Another method of cognitive shuffling involves conjuring different imagery in your mind to help you escape random thoughts or leftover anxieties from the day. As you lie in bed, think of random words like “cow” and imagine them. Create visuals in your mind so you can drift off to sleep. You can also use your heartbeat as your guide. Think of a non-emotional word like “horse,” and on each heartbeat, think of a word that starts with the first letter. The trick is to keep each word random, going with the first image that comes to mind.
Cognitive shuffling gently nudges your brain away from worries and wandering thoughts that cause insomnia, easing you into a calm state. When you embrace random words and images that distract you from intrusive thoughts, you give yourself permission to get the rest you need. Sweet dreams are just a shuffle away!
BECOME A MODERN-DAY EXPLORER
Movies like “Raiders of the Lost Ark,” “The Goonies,” and “National Treasure” have inspired generations to hunt for buried treasure. We’ve all dreamt of discovering a forgotten relic that would change the world and earn us fame and fortune. Most of us will likely never uncover any artifacts worth an article in our local newspapers, but that doesn’t mean we have to give up on the treasure-hunting dream. Going on your very own treasure hunt has never been easier, thanks to geocaching. For those unfamiliar, geocaching is a treasure-hunting game that invites people worldwide to search for and discover hidden caches. You can find hidden secrets around your community and beyond using a GPS and a geocaching app. Geocaching is the official app and one of the best places to start your geocaching expedition. From there, you’ll just have to pick a cache nearby and start searching. There are a few different types of caches to discover. The most common is the basic cache, requiring you to go to a specific GPS coordinate. There, you’ll use observational skills to locate the cache. Another type, an EarthCache, doesn’t involve a hidden object but instead leads you to a unique geographical feature. Those looking for a real challenge will enjoy finding mystery caches that require the discoverer to solve a riddle, cipher, or puzzle. Once you’ve discovered your fair share of geocaches, you may want to explore the other side of the operation and hide some yourself. Most members of the geocaching community recommend that you discover and log at least 20 caches before hiding your own. That way, you’ll be familiar with the rules of hiding and maintaining a cache.
Geocaching is a great way to get outdoors and reignite your passion for exploring. You never know what you’ll find!
